Sharkey’s seems like an institution/hole-in-the wall here in Dewey, and I must say they delivered some tasty Cubano sandwiches on our breakfast run before heading to the beach. The Cubano was delicious, very tender slices of pork, ham, and cheese, on a bun that had the texture and firmness that I grew accustomed to on my weekend trips to Miami. We also tried the breakfast sandwich($ 5.75) which was a grilled egg, cheese, and choice of sausage, ham, or bacon. I opted for bacon on an english muffin and it was a McMuffin on steroids. Least I not forget they serve free coffee for patrons! I myself am a huge coffee snob and instead strolled over to the convenience store across the street to get a cup of Green Mountain dark roast Espresso blend, but for those who don’t mind standard run-of-the-mill coffee, then you’ll save yourself $ 3. Cheap, tasty, plenty of seating on their patio, and free coffee… what more could one ask for? Thumbs up.

Hole in the wall indeed. Stopped in for breakfast with the gf and she ordered the pancakes. I heard good things on Unilocal about the Cuban sandwich and not so good things about their breakfast food so I thought let’s see if they make sandwiches at 9am. Turns out they do. After ordering at the window we took a seat at their outdoor deck, which is the only option available. They offer free coffee, which I thought was a nice perk. The food came out about 10 minutes later. The 2 pancakes comes with a syrup packet on a styrofoam plate. The pancakes were fluffy, but dry and needed every last ounce of syrup. 2 stars. The Cuban does not come on Cuban bread, but it is still tasty and a good portion of meat. The sandwich comes with a bag of ruffles. I’d give it 3 stars — not sure how anyone could give it a 5. 2 stars for the pancakes, 3 stars for the sandwich and a ½ star bump for the free coffee. Sharky’s is good for that quick breakfast, Cuban sandwich hankering, free coffee, or dog friendly spot. I wouldn’t go out of my way to come here, but you could do a lot worse.

I really wanted to like this place, I mean they’re pet friendly and have free coffee and the owner seems to be a nice guy. However, the food was overpriced and under-flavored. I ordered an egg and bacon sandwich on wheat toast and hubby ordered a cuban, which you would think would be delicious since there are signs suggesting you try one, leading one to believe that it’s their specialty. I was actually quite shocked when I unwrapped my sandwich to add salt and pepper and discovered this sad, thin fried egg topped with a circular piece of bacon. The bacon was tasteless and the egg had no flavor whatsoever, I had to add an ungodly amount of salt just to make it edible. Hubby’s cuban was just okay, nothing to write home about, unlike the one he had a few weeks prior at another establishment. The one saving grace to the whole meal as the hash brown potato chunks, they were hot and quite tasty. To add insult to injury Sharky’s doesn’t accept credit cards so I had to pay $ 3 to use the ATM conveniently located in the makeshift restaurant. It’s pretty bad when you find yourself saying I wish we had gone to McDonalds. I gave it 2 stars because it’s dog friendly and the owner was very hospitable.

I want to love this place, I really do. The service was great, we walked up and were immediately greeted by a man who introduced himself as Sharky. He told us about many of the menu items, and made some recommendations. We thought the prices were a little steep, but usually places like this give you heaps of food. However, when we received our food, we were disappointed to find that the $ 5 onion rings was a total of 6 rings! The food was delicious, but you don’t get much for what you pay. Also, they charge a plate sharing fee! I’ve never seen such a thing at an out-doors beach snack shack sort of place. At upscale restaurants, sure, but not a joint like this. Also, it was quite weird that you pay after you eat. They made mention that they have people walk out before paying. I think that if they have you pay first, like other places, you wouldn’t have that problem, it would save money, and possibly bring prices down. I don’t want the cost of some jerks’ free meals passed down to me.

Very good sandwiches and wraps! I like the laid back atmosphere here. A few picnic tables set up near some shady maple trees… makes you forget you’re sitting next to a highway. The owner Sharky is most always there which I really like. He is nice to talk to when he’s socializing… a bit grouchy when he’s actually working. I always get the turkey wrap here. Very good. It’s a bit pricey at $ 9.50 but it’s hard to find any cheap food in Dewey. A turkey foot long at Subway is $ 8 to put things into perspective. I have also ordered a turkey on toast at Sharky’s. It’s not on the menu but they made it and it was only $ 6. Nice sized sandwich and I took it to the beach with me. Free coffee; dogs are welcome and there’s a large water bowl available Only open for breakfast and lunch. I believe they close at 2pm daily.
